In this role, employee will co-develop & implement processes relating to readiness and capacity with your assigned commodity and suppliers.

Employee will lead the implementation of this process with specific suppliers ensuring that there is cadence and proactive problem solving in the space. The goal for this role will be to ensure there is an understanding of current state and a plan to meet global requirements from this commodity as demand increases over a rolling 3-year window, extending out to 10 years.

The role has autonomy within the Commodity to create and drive rhythms to serve readiness and requires high levels of evaluative judgment and operational acumen to achieve desired business outcomes.

What You’ll Do

Readiness & Capacity Planning

  • Partner with the Central Readiness team to learn, implement, and continuously improve the readiness process for your assigned commodities and internal/external suppliers

  • Build commodity-specific capacity models across the value chain (e.g., key process steps, suppliers, and operations) to quantify where constraints exist

  • Use data and capacity models to visualize constraints
    , understand root causes, and prioritize improvement actions

Constraint Management & Action Plans

  • Develop structured action plans to alleviate constraints in partnership with PF teams, Supplier Quality, Sourcing, and suppliers

  • Apply structured problem solving (e.g., root cause analysis, 5-why, fishbone) to address delivery, capacity, or process issues

  • Lead cross-functional teams, assign clear owners and due dates, and create accountability around action plan execution

  • Conduct on-site visits and use other verification methods (e.g., data reviews, Gemba walks) to confirm that improvements are real and sustainable, especially for material receipts and capacity increases

Stakeholder Engagement & Communication

  • Engage with commodity leadership and key stakeholders on a regular cadence (meetings, reviews, updates) to report readiness status and drive decisions

  • Work directly with Supplier Teams and suppliers to build capacity, improve readiness, and maintain alignment on plans and expectations

  • Support the PF S&OP (Sales & Operations Planning) process by providing realistic input on supplier and source constraints

  • Communicate source constraints and capacity changes to be incorporated into S&OP rhythms so the business can respond appropriately to demand changes

Standards, Metrics, and Daily Management

  • Develop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) for readiness, such as capacity vs. demand, on-time delivery, lead time, and action plan closure

  • Create and document standard work for readiness processes within your commodity so the approach is repeatable and sustainable

  • Support daily management processes for your commodity, including tiered meetings, visual management, and follow-up on critical issues
